Is it right to say that Borland basically invented the IDE? I didn't use Turbo Pascal but did have a copy of Turbo C back in the day and that was certainly the first IDE-like programming environment I can remember.

Long before the term IDE was coined, there were source code editors from within which you could run the shell commands required to build a software project and you could examine their output, e.g. the error messages.

Moreover, interpreters that offered a complete interactive environment for editing, running and debugging programs, had existed for decades for languages like APL and LISP.

Nonetheless, the availability of Turbo Pascal on cheap computers has probably introduced much more people to such a programming environment than the older alternatives, which were available only on big and expensive computers, so at most they were accessible through time-sharing services in big companies or in universities.

I have used Turbo Pascal on 8080- and Z80-based computers running the CP/M operating system, before becoming able to use IBM PC compatibles, where the Microsoft and Borland C and C++ compilers were a better alternative, and it was a good progress over what I had used previously, but before that, in the university I had used a "Remote Job Entry" system which accessed by time-sharing a computer mainframe from a serial video terminal, and you could do with it everything that you could do with Turbo Pascal (for programs written in Fortran), except that its source code editor was far more awkward (it was a line-oriented text editor, where you could see the source code, but to edit a line it was extracted into a buffer at the bottom of the screen and merged back into the source code when editing it was complete).

On CP/M, Turbo Pascal was the most convenient programming environment, but for serious work, where run-time performance mattered, I was using the Microsoft Fortran compiler for CP/M, enhanced by replacing a few of the subroutines from its run-time library with optimized variants. Pascal is really much too weak for number-crunching problems, even if it may be acceptable for non-numeric problems that are not too complex (the original Pascal does not support multi-file programs, Turbo Pascal was extended in a non-standard way to support this).

I wrote Pascal for 8080 in 1976 and Finnish Army even paid some money for it. I was truly disappointed that Turbo Pascal did not copy my handy PORT-metavariable. You can write & read IO-ports without any extra hässle: https://photos.app.goo.gl/qeJpYb94XzLBCE139

Turbo Pascal supported port array though: https://archive.org/details/bitsavers_borlandturVersion3.0Re...

Here is the first function of your example in TP3: procedure DataOut; begin while (Port[$f5] and 1) = 0 do; port[$f4] := Data; end,

Is it right to say that Borland basically invented the IDE? I didn't use Turbo Pascal but did have a copy of Turbo C back in the day and that was certainly the first IDE-like programming environment I can remember.

No, Xerox PARC invented the IDE, just like they did with the GUI.

https://en.wikipedia.org/wiki/Xerox_Star

https://en.wikipedia.org/wiki/Xerox_Development_Environment

IDEs go back to how Mesa (Tajo), Interlisp-D and Smalltalk work.
